There’s A New Team in Town

Spring is a season for new beginnings, outdoor activities, and warmer weather.  It’s a time to step outside and find your friends for fresh air fun.  This year, The Education Foundation of BCPS, Inc., in partnership with The Baseball Warehouse and League of Dreams have joined together to launch a brand-new initiative.  It’s called “Let’s Play Ball!”, a community event that includes a softball game between TEAM BCPS administrators and educators for some friendly competition.  Darryl L. Williams, Ed.D, Superintendent of Baltimore County Public Schools will be the inaugural “Let’s Play Ball!” Honorary Chair.

The initiative began through a creative discussion proposed by Mr. Joe Mondell, Vice President of Advancement for the foundation.  In an effort to celebrate our schools and bring the BCPS community together, the “Let’s Play Ball!” idea grew.   Through active discussions with board members, committee members, staff, and community partners the event developed.  The day will open with a League of Dreams skills camp and exhibit game with BCPS Allied Sports athletes, followed by the main event, a pleasant, fun filled competition between BCPS administrators and educators   Live music and food trucks will also be there adding to the festivities.
